HI Deepak, We actually never hosted jquery UI version 1.8.20. We went from 1.8.19 to 1.8.21. Can you update your URLs to point at 1.8.21?
Thanks, Bryan On Fri, Jul 13, 2012 at 12:43 PM, Deepak Mittal <[email protected]> wrote: > 2 of my websites using Google CDN for jquery-ui broke when > http://ajax.googleapis.com/ajax/libs/jqueryui/1.8.20/jquery-ui.min.js > started giving 404 errors. This link used to work fine earlier. I can fix my > code, but I'm pretty sure this must've broken a lot of other websites too.
